I purchased my Sony Z3 a week ago and it has been working great until lunchtime today. I was wondering why I hadn't received any responses from my earlier texts and went to look at my phone and it was off. I pushed and held the power button forever, nothing. I placed on the charger to see if it would light up or make some sort of sound, nothing. I do not have a removeable battery to take out and put back to see if it would come on, so I'm at a loss on what to do now other than take it back to the store. Anyone else have this problem or have a suggestion?
Solved! Go to Correct Answer
Simulate a battery pull with:
Hold the Volume Down button and then the Power key and hold these two buttons down simultaneously for about 15-20 seconds. After holding them down for about 20 seconds if the phone didn’t power cycle then release the keys and try and turn the phone on like you normally would by briefly pressing the power button. If that doesn't work then try Volume Up instead of Volume Down.

This worked, it came on and said system recovery and I had to choose what I wanted to do, safe mode or continue start up.
Thank you so much. Can you tell me why this happened, will it continue to be a problem and should I still take it back to the store? I have 3 more days to change my mind and get something else….just wondering if I should.

Hopefully just a hiccup things like this happen on occasion with most devices, if it happens again with that time frame you may want to take it back and have it checked out. From what I hear the Xperia Z3 is a great device and does have a 1 year warranty which would cover any real hardware issues. Good luck and enjoy your new phone.
